Navigating Bonuses and Promotions
One of the key draws of this platform is its frequent offering of bonuses and promotions. These can range from welcome bonuses for new players to reload bonuses for existing users, as well as free spins and cashback offers. However, it’s vitally important to carefully read the terms and conditions associated with each bonus. These terms often include wagering requirements, which dictate how much a player must bet before they can withdraw any winnings generated from the bonus. High wagering requirements can significantly reduce the actual value of a bonus, making it more difficult to convert into real money. Understanding these conditions is essential for maximizing the benefits of promotions and avoiding disappointment. Players should also be aware of any game restrictions associated with bonuses, as some games may contribute less towards fulfilling wagering requirements than others.
| Bonus Type | Typical Wagering Requirement | Game Restrictions |
|---|---|---|
| Welcome Bonus | 35x – 50x | Slots, Keno, Scratch Cards |
| Reload Bonus | 40x – 60x | May exclude certain progressive jackpots |
| Free Spins | 30x – 45x | Specific slot game(s) only |
| Cashback Bonus | 10x – 20x | Limited to losses incurred |
The table above showcases some typical bonus structures and associated conditions. Remember that these figures are indicative and can vary significantly between different promotions and at different times. It is always advisable to check the latest terms and conditions directly on the platform’s website.

Verification Processes and KYC
To ensure fairness and prevent fraudulent activity, this platform, like many others, implements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ures. This involves verifying the identity of players by requesting documentation such as proof of address and a copy of a valid government-issued ID. The KYC process is typically triggered when a player wishes to make a large withdrawal or has reached a certain cumulative deposit threshold. While it can be initially inconvenient, KYC is a standard industry practice and is essential for maintaining the integrity of the platform. Players should ensure that the documents they submit are clear, legible, and up-to-date to avoid delays in the verification process. Understanding that this isn't a personalized attack, but a standard procedure, can help ease potential frustration.

Withdrawal Methods and Processing Times
One of the most important aspects of any online gaming platform is the efficiency and reliability of its withdrawal process. This site offers a range of withdrawal methods, including bank transfers, e-wallets, and cryptocurrency options. However, processing times can vary significantly depending on the chosen method and the player’s VIP level. E-wallets generally offer the fastest withdrawal times, often processing requests within 24-48 hours. Bank transfers, on the other hand, can take several business days to complete. Cryptocurrency withdrawals are generally fast, but are subject to network congestion and confirmation times. Players should carefully review the platform’s withdrawal policy to understand the associated fees, limits, and processing times for each method. It's also crucial to ensure that the withdrawal method is in the player’s name to avoid complications. Delays are sometimes caused by incomplete KYC verification, so it's wise to get that completed beforehand.

Responsible Gaming and Support Resources
Prioritizing responsible gaming is paramount. The platform offers various tools to help players manage their gaming habits, including de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. Deposit limits allow players to restrict the amount of money they can deposit into their account within a specific timeframe. Loss limits, conversely, allow players to limit the amount of money they can lose within a timeframe. Self-exclusion, the most drastic measure, involves temporarily or permanently blocking access to the platform. Players should utilize these tools proactively to prevent overspending and maintain control.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, resources are available to provide support. The platform often lists links to reputable organizations dedicated to responsible gaming. Remember that gaming should be a fun and entertaining pastime, not a source of stress or financial hardship.
